Postby DeadlyPencil » Sun Mar 24, 2019 8:25 pm

basically what happens is you grab what q u want out of a stockpile to craft. then u click craft, accidnetly leaving the stockpile open. It then takes it from the stockpile istead of from your inventory for whatever reason. basically using stuff u have absoultly no clue what quality it is.

if it used stuff from your inventory FIRST, it probably wouldnt be so bad, but it doesn't.
